Substantial desire has lately been drawn to your iodates owing to the large nonlinear optical interactions (next harmonic and photoelastic) described in α�?HIO 3 . During the present perform, a lot of the photoelastic and piezoelectric constants and connected Attributes of one‐crystal lithium iodate LiIO 3 are already determined. The acousto‐optic determine of benefit for LiIO 3 has become uncovered to generally be only about 15% of that for α�?HIO three , earning the fabric unattractive as an acousto‐optic medium.

Dependant on the linear piezoelectric coupling equation, the relations among the ultrasonic velocities and elastic moduli are received. The velocities of longitudinal and shear waves which propagate together distinctive symmetry click here directions of α-LiIO3 crystal are determined by the pulse echo overlap approach. We report new vibrational modes in solitary crystal Li2GeO3, grown because of the Czochralski process. The brand new modes were based on delicate Raman spectroscopic measurements in varied scattering geometries. The observed number of modes agrees Using the quantity predicted by group theory.
